JATA TOURISM EXPO JAPAN 2017

October 2, 2017 by StrawberrY Gal

Tourism Selangor together with the state’s Kuala Selangor District Council connects businesses from the state of Selangor and Japan in a B2B sessions at JATA Tourism EXPO 2017, which took take place on Thursday, September 21st, until Sunday, September 24th 2017 at Tokyo Big Sight in Tokyo.

The event provides participants that came from various travel agencies, government agencies and hoteliers to connect with travel industry associates.

“Selangor’s tourism industry still has a lot of potential for development and can be explored even further, particularly with our counterparts here in Japan.  In our quest to be an active and thriving tourism industry, we at Tourism Selangor and the Selangor government are supportive of all efforts by our local industry players to develop the attractive products available at our home, such as; Eco Nature, Agro Tourism, Homestay, Heritage and Culture”, said Madam Noorul Ashikin Mohd Din, General Manager of Tourism Selangor.

“We are confident that Selangor’s Tourism Products would receive an encouraging response from the Japanese tourists as they always like anything new and different. What we will initiate together with Kuala Selangor District Council and Hakuba Tourism Association is a powerful platform that can help drive the tourist arrival from Japan and getting them to go further around Selangor and stay longer. Local businesses can capitalise this inbound interest to grow the economy of the state in the long term,” she added.

Statistics have shown that there is an increase of 211.38% tourist’s arrival from Japan, in the first quarter of the year, from January – April 2016 (20,026), to January – April 2017 (62,356). While the popular destination for Japanese, coming to Selangor, Malaysia may prove to be worthy of the attention for those who go for longer holidays.
This year, Tourism Selangor, Kuala Selangor District Council and Hakuba Tourism Association are taking the opportunity to use the expo’s platform to initiate the collaboration between 2 cities, Selangor’s district, Kuala Selangor and Hakuba Goryu, Japan. The collaboration is an initiative to promote cooperation and expertise in tourism aspects between both cities.

The twin cities will be collaborating to promote its firefly’s products, which aimed to learn more about the preservation of firefly colonies in Kampung Kuantan, Kuala Selangor and to work hand in hand for the development of Tourism between the 2 cities. This cooperation is a continuation effort of the JATA’s participation in 2016. Tourism Selangor has also received an official visit from Hakuba Tourism Association on last 8th of September, in Kuala Selangor. Counter-visits from Tourism Selangor and Kuala Selangor District Council will continue officially to Hakuba Goryu City after the participation of JATA 2017, which will be hosted by Hakuba Tourism Association.

The ongoing Discover Selangor campaign is a benchmark for Tourism Selangor in promoting new and old products that have not garnered much attention, thus highlighting and promoting them to the public as well as the tourism market, domestically and abroad. The accompanying ‘Heart of Malaysia’ is used as a slogan to strengthen the current promotional campaign, specifically indicating Selangor state as a hub for transportation, development, investment, business, education, medicine and others – where it all begins and centered in the Selangor state.
